This Advanced Certificate in Biostatistics for Health Equity Policy equips students with the advanced statistical skills needed to analyze health data and inform policy decisions that promote health equity. The program focuses on developing expertise in methods relevant to understanding and addressing health disparities.
Learning outcomes include mastering advanced statistical techniques for analyzing complex health data, including regression modeling, causal inference, and survival analysis. Students will also gain proficiency in utilizing statistical software packages commonly used in public health and epidemiology research, like R and SAS, to conduct health equity research and develop evidence-based policy recommendations. This includes interpreting results and effectively communicating findings to diverse audiences.
